The first all-inclusive text covering coordination polymerisation, including important classes of non-hydrocarbon monomers. Charting the achievements and progress in the field, in terms of both basic and industrial research, this book offers a unified and complete overview of coordination polymerisation. * Provides detailed description of the historical development of the subject * Presents a unified view of catalysis, mechanisms, structures and utility * Encourages learning through a step-by-step progression from basic to in-depth text * Features end-of-chapter exercises to reinforce understanding * Offers a full bibliography and comprehensive literature review Requisite reading for research students studying introductory and advanced courses in; polymer science, catalysis and polymerisation catalysis, and valuable reference for researchers and technicians in industry.
